Output e5afac3d64f6d84d851486a88a49c047568fcb0f69bc87601873f9e26a190bb9:1

value
21204000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f87fa7b41cc121d30fd7f38232e24fac632da4b OP_EQUAL
address
A5XCBmaPD2M8F7RVLzRis8hoP6XoCvLKdc
transaction
e5afac3d64f6d84d851486a88a49c047568fcb0f69bc87601873f9e26a190bb9